The Domino problem is undecidable on every rhombus subshift

We extend the classical Domino problem to any tiling of rhombus-shaped tiles. For any subshift X of edge-to-edge rhombus tilings, such as the Penrose subshift, we prove that the associated X-Domino problem is Π^0_1 -hard and therefore undecidable. It is Π^0_1 -complete when the subshift X is given by a computable sequence of forbidden patterns.
